William Davenant, English Poet Laureate
Sir William Davenant (1606-1668), also spelled D'Avenant, was an English poet and playwright. He was one of the rare figures in English Renaissance theatre whose career spanned both the Caroline and Restoration eras and who was active both before and after the English Civil War and during the Interregnum. Poet Laureate, 1637-1668
